As has been been said, if we're talking boxing fundamentals then Cotto is the more skilled fighter. Calzaghe has five key attributes that make him a better fighter though and a better fighter than most:
1. Hand speed - having immense hand speed means that he can land shots against the best defence and in reality it means that sometimes he gets credited for shots that don't land that cleanly.
2. Fitness/Stamina - this lets Calzaghe work for every second of every round. This means that he usually forces opponents to try and keep up. It also means that in close rounds he usually gets the nod.
3. Adaptability - throughout his career, both inbetween fights and in the middle of fights Calzaghe has shown a rare ability to change style in order to get a fight won. For the best example see the Kessler fight. Calzaghe stops squaring his shoulders and starts boxing Kessler from the outside with one-two combinations, frustrating Kessler who came with the plan to counter punch all night.
4. Chin - say what you like about him being put down in his final two fights, but Calzaghe could definately take a punch well. Four knockdowns in a career for a guy who nearly always got caught flush once during a fight due to over-eagerness is impressive. Even moreso when you consider that his final knockdown wasn't even legitimate. Being able to take a punch definately meant that Calzaghe could survive where others couldn't.
5. Jab - the only technical thing Calzaghe does fairly textbook. For a guy who can't punch that hard, he gets good pop behind his jab, opening a fighter up for flurries and scoring vital points. Quick and accurate to boot.
